Leaky Faucets
Dripping taps can be a frustrating nuisance for property owners. These consistent leaks not only produce an irritating audio yet additionally result in squandered water and boosted utility costs. A dripping tap commonly arises from worn-out washing machines, O-rings, or seals, which deteriorate gradually due to normal use and direct exposure to water. Sometimes, the tap's interior elements might be worn away or damaged, necessitating a much more comprehensive fixing or substitute. Recognizing the resource of the leakage is essential; house owners might require to dismantle the faucet to examine its parts very closely. Routine upkeep can aid protect against leakages, consisting of cleansing aerators and examining for signs of wear. Resolving a leaking faucet quickly can conserve water and reduce expenses, making it a manageable yet vital job for homeowners to tackle in preserving their plumbing systems effectively. Reasons of Running Toilets
A persistent flow of water from a bathroom can be both annoying and inefficient, usually signifying underlying concerns within the plumbing system. One common reason is a used flapper shutoff, which might not create a correct seal, allowing water to constantly leakage right into the bowl. Additionally, a malfunctioning fill shutoff can result in excessive water flow, adding to the problem. Misaligned float mechanisms might additionally trigger the commode to run as they fail to manage the water degree suitably. An additional prospective concern is mineral accumulation, which can block components and prevent their capability. Identifying these causes immediately can help house owners address the problem before it rises, making sure effective procedure of their plumbing system.

Burst Pipes
Burst pipes can be a severe pipes issue, often arising from the exact same aspects that add to low water pressure, such as temperature fluctuations and maturing facilities. When water freezes within pipelines, it increases, enhancing pressure till the pipeline can no longer contain it, causing a tear. Additionally, rust from prolonged exposure to water can deteriorate pipes, making them at risk to bursting under normal pressure.Homeowners might see indicators of a burst pipe through abrupt water leakages, wet places on ceilings or wall surfaces, and an unanticipated rise in their water expense. Immediate activity is important; failing to attend to a burst pipe can cause comprehensive water damage, mold development, and expensive repair services. Normal inspections and upkeep of plumbing systems can help stop this issue. In addition, protecting pipes in cooler locations and replacing old piping can significantly minimize the risk of burst pipes, safeguarding the home's pipes stability.
Hot Water Heater Issues
Just how can home owners determine hot water heater concerns before they escalate? address Normal inspection and maintenance can assist detect potential problems early. Home owners must look for indications such as inconsistent water temperature level, uncommon sounds, or a decrease in hot water supply. Leakages or pools around the unit might show a malfunction that requires prompt focus. The look of rust or sediment buildup can likewise signal the requirement for maintenance.Additionally, home owners need to monitor the age of their water heating unit; most units have a life-span of 8 to 12 years. If the heater is approaching this age and revealing indicators of wear, it may be time to review replacement. Normal flushing of the storage tank can stop sediment build-up, prolonging the system's life. By staying cautious and dealing with issues immediately, homeowners can prevent costly repair services and guarantee their hot water heater operates effectively for several years to come.
